Lincoln's Inn Campus

London United Kingdom

The Inns of Court College of Advocacy at Lincoln's Inn Campus specializes in advanced legal training for aspiring barristers and legal professionals. This historic location, central to the UK's legal heritage, offers a comprehensive curriculum focused on advocacy skills essential for courtroom practice.

  • Bar Professional Training Course (BPTC): A rigorous one-year program covering civil and criminal litigation, evidence, and professional ethics, preparing students for pupillage and tenancy applications.
  • Advanced Advocacy Workshops: Intensive sessions on oral advocacy, cross-examination techniques, and witness handling, conducted in mock courtrooms simulating real trials.
  • Legal Ethics and Professional Conduct: Courses exploring the Bar Standards, confidentiality, and conflicts of interest, with case studies from landmark judgments.
  • Mooting and Debate Competitions: Regular internal and national moots to hone persuasive speaking and legal argumentation skills.
  • Specialized Modules in Commercial Advocacy: Training on arbitration, mediation, and international dispute resolution for corporate law practitioners.

Students benefit from mentorship by practicing barristers and judges, with access to extensive libraries and dining halls for networking. The program emphasizes practical experience, including observed placements in chambers. Graduates achieve high success rates in securing pupillages, with alumni including leading Queen's Counsel. This campus fosters a collegial environment, blending tradition with modern teaching methods like video analysis of advocacy performances. Additional electives include human rights advocacy and appellate practice, ensuring a well-rounded education. The curriculum is continually updated to reflect evolving legal landscapes, such as digital evidence and remote hearings post-pandemic. Overall, the Lincoln's Inn Campus provides an immersive, elite training ground for the next generation of advocates, with over 300 hours of hands-on instruction annually.
